Abstract :
[en] The interactions and miscibility analysis of gluten-emulsifiers mixed film show that those films are not completely miscible as demonstrated by the presence of both two transition zones and also by the deviation of the mean molecular areas of mixed films from the values calculated according to the rule of additivity (GAINES, 1966). Furthermore, the free energy excess of mixing is positive in presence of emulsifiers, confirming the partial miscibility of gluten emulsifier monolayers.
